“ O’ Allah, I seek refuge in You from leprosy, elephantiasis,2
madness and evil diseases.” 3

1. Translated and compiled by Abu Yusuf Sagheer bin ‘Abdir-Rasheed al-Kashmeeree.


2. Al-Judhaam (elephantiasis) is a type of leprosy which causes certain limbs of the body to corrode
and eventually fall off. See: An Arabic-English Lexicon by Edward William Lane, Vol. 2, page 398,
Libraire Du Liban, Beirut, 1997.
3. Reported by Abu Dawud (No.1554, page 238, Maktabatul-Ma’aarif, Riyadh, 1st Edition, 1417) and
authenticated by Sheikh al-Albaanee, may Allah have mercy on him, as Saheeh in Saheeh-ul-Jaami’-as-
Sagheer Wa Ziyadah (No.1281, Vol.1, page 275, Al-Maktab-ul-Islaamee, Beirut, 3rd Edition, 1407/1988)
and Saheeh Sunan Abee Dawud – Al-Umm (No.1390, Vol.5, Pp 276-277, Muassasatu-Ghiraas, Kuwait, 1st
Edition, 1423/2002).

“ O’ Allah, keep me away from vile manners, (vile) actions, (vile)
desires and (vile) diseases.” 4

“ O’ Allah, give me good health in my body,
O’ Allah, give me good health in my hearing,
O’ Allah, give me good health in my sight.
None has the right to be worshipped except You.” 6

“ Seek refuge in Allah from the difficult situation of the calamity
(which cannot be endured or repelled), (from) being overtaken by a
miserable destruction (in the world and the hereafter), (from) the evil
of that which has been pre-decreed (for life, the point of death and the
hereafter) and (from) the malicious joy of the enemies during (your)
affliction.” 7

“ O’ Allah, indeed I seek refuge in You from the disappearance of
Your blessing, (from) the departure of the wellbeing that is from You,
(from) the suddenness of Your punishment and (from) all of Your
displeasure. “ 8
